What is Testosterone Therapy?

Testosterone therapy (TT) is a medical treatment used to address low levels of testosterone in the body. Testosterone is a hormone that plays a key role in the development of male physical features and reproductive functions. While women also produce testosterone, it is in much smaller amounts. This hormone is essential for maintaining muscle mass, bone density, and sex drive.

Definition and Purpose of TT

Testosterone therapy is prescribed to increase the levels of testosterone in men whose bodies do not produce enough of it naturally. This condition is known as hypogonadism. Hypogonadism can be due to problems with the testicles, pituitary gland, or hypothalamus. It can also occur as a part of aging, where the body gradually produces less testosterone over time.

The purpose of TT is to alleviate the symptoms associated with low testosterone levels. Common symptoms of low testosterone include fatigue, depression, reduced muscle mass, increased body fat, and decreased libido. By restoring testosterone to normal levels, therapy can improve these symptoms and enhance the overall quality of life.

Conditions Treated with TT

  • Primary Hypogonadism: This occurs when the testicles are not functioning properly. Causes can include genetic conditions such as Klinefelter syndrome, or damage from injury, infection, or chemotherapy.
  • Secondary Hypogonadism: This is when the problem lies in the hypothalamus or pituitary gland, which is responsible for signaling the testicles to produce testosterone. Conditions such as pituitary disorders or certain inflammatory diseases can lead to secondary hypogonadism.
  • Age-related Low Testosterone: As men age, testosterone levels naturally decline. This decrease can sometimes cause symptoms that are improved with TT.

Methods of Administration

There are several ways testosterone can be administered, each with its advantages and disadvantages:

  1. Injections: These are some of the most common methods. Testosterone is injected into the muscle, usually every one to two weeks. This method is effective but can cause fluctuations in testosterone levels, leading to highs and lows between doses.
  2. Patches: Testosterone patches are applied to the skin daily. They provide a steady release of testosterone but can sometimes cause skin irritation.
  3. Gels: These are applied to the skin on a daily basis. The testosterone is absorbed through the skin and provides consistent hormone levels. However, there is a risk of transferring the medication to others through skin contact.
  4. Implants: Small pellets containing testosterone are implanted under the skin, typically in the buttocks or abdomen. These pellets slowly release testosterone over a period of several months. This method requires minor surgery but offers the benefit of long-term release without the need for daily application.
  5. Oral Tablets: Some forms of testosterone can be taken orally. These are less commonly used because they can cause liver damage over time.
  6. Buccal Systems: These are small tablets that stick to the gums and release testosterone directly into the bloodstream. They need to be applied twice daily.

Monitoring and Side Effects

Regular monitoring is essential during testosterone therapy. Blood tests are needed to check testosterone levels and ensure they are within the target range. Doctors also monitor for potential side effects, which can include:

  1. Polycythemia: An increase in red blood cell count, which can thicken the blood and increase the risk of heart disease.
  2. Sleep Apnea: TT can worsen this condition, which is characterized by pauses in breathing during sleep.
  3. Prostate Health: Testosterone can stimulate the growth of the prostate, potentially worsening benign prostatic hyperplasia (BPH) or contributing to prostate cancer.
  4. Skin Reactions: Skin irritation can occur, especially with patches and gels.
  5. Mood Changes: Some men experience changes in mood, including increased aggression or irritability.

How Does Alcohol Affect Testosterone Levels?

Alcohol affects your body in many ways. One area it influences is your hormones, including testosterone. Testosterone is a key hormone in both men and women, although men have higher levels. It plays a crucial role in muscle growth, mood regulation, and sexual health. Understanding how alcohol impacts testosterone can help you make informed decisions about your health, especially if you are on testosterone therapy (TT).

Short-term Effects of Alcohol on Testosterone Levels

When you drink alcohol, it enters your bloodstream quickly. This can cause several short-term effects on your hormone levels. For example, consuming alcohol can lower your testosterone levels almost immediately. This drop happens because alcohol increases the conversion of testosterone into estrogen, the primary female hormone. As estrogen levels rise, testosterone levels fall. This effect is more noticeable if you drink a lot of alcohol in a short period.

Another short-term effect of alcohol is its impact on the production of luteinizing hormone (LH). LH is produced by the pituitary gland and signals the testes to produce testosterone. Alcohol can reduce the secretion of LH, leading to lower testosterone production. This effect can be seen even with moderate drinking.

Long-term Effects of Alcohol on Testosterone Levels

Long-term alcohol use can have more serious consequences for your testosterone levels and overall health. Chronic alcohol consumption can lead to permanent damage to the endocrine system, which is responsible for hormone production and regulation. Over time, heavy drinking can reduce the size and function of the testes, leading to lower testosterone production.

One major concern with long-term alcohol use is liver damage. The liver plays a crucial role in regulating hormone levels. It breaks down and removes excess hormones from the body, including estrogen. When the liver is damaged by alcohol, it cannot perform this function efficiently. This can lead to a buildup of estrogen, which further lowers testosterone levels.

Long-term alcohol use can also increase cortisol levels. Cortisol is a stress hormone that, when elevated, can suppress testosterone production. High cortisol levels are often seen in individuals who consume alcohol regularly, adding another layer of complexity to the impact on testosterone.

What are the Risks of Combining Alcohol with Testosterone Therapy?

Combining alcohol with testosterone therapy (TT) can lead to several health risks. These risks involve the liver, cardiovascular system, hormone levels, and overall health. Understanding these dangers is crucial for anyone undergoing TT.

Impact on Liver Function

The liver plays a key role in breaking down alcohol and processing hormones. When you drink alcohol, your liver works hard to remove it from your body. If you are also on TT, your liver must handle both tasks at once. This can put extra stress on your liver.

Long-term alcohol use can lead to liver damage, including fatty liver disease, hepatitis, and cirrhosis. Adding TT to this mix can worsen these conditions. A damaged liver may not process testosterone effectively, reducing the benefits of TT and potentially leading to higher levels of testosterone in the blood. This imbalance can cause more side effects.

Increased Cardiovascular Risks

Both alcohol and TT can impact your cardiovascular system. Moderate alcohol use may have some heart benefits, but heavy drinking can raise your blood pressure and cause heart disease. TT can also affect your heart, especially if you have pre-existing conditions.

Combining alcohol with TT can increase your risk of heart problems. Alcohol raises blood pressure and cholesterol levels, while TT can cause fluid retention and affect cholesterol levels, too. Together, they can put extra strain on your heart and blood vessels.

Hormonal Imbalance

Alcohol can disrupt the balance of hormones in your body. It can lower your testosterone levels, which is the opposite of what TT aims to achieve. When you drink, your body produces more of an enzyme called aromatase. This enzyme converts testosterone into estrogen, a hormone that can counteract the effects of TT.

High estrogen levels in men can lead to side effects such as gynecomastia (breast tissue growth), mood swings, and sexual dysfunction. These side effects can undermine the benefits of TT and affect your quality of life.

Interference with Treatment Goals

One of the main goals of TT is to improve symptoms of low testosterone, such as low energy, mood swings, and reduced muscle mass. Alcohol can interfere with these goals in several ways.

Drinking can make you feel tired and depressed, which can counteract the energy boost from TT. It can also affect your sleep, leading to poor recovery and muscle growth. Alcohol’s negative effects on mood can interfere with the mood-stabilizing benefits of TT, making it harder to manage symptoms of low testosterone.

Increased Risk of Side Effects

Both alcohol and TT have their own side effects. When combined, these side effects can become more severe. For example, TT can cause acne, mood swings, and changes in red blood cell levels. Alcohol can worsen these side effects, leading to more significant health issues.

Alcohol can also increase the risk of certain side effects specific to TT, such as fluid retention and high blood pressure. It can affect your liver’s ability to process medications, leading to higher levels of testosterone in your blood and more severe side effects.

Mechanisms by Which Alcohol Can Alter TT Effectiveness

Alcohol can influence testosterone levels and the effectiveness of testosterone therapy in several ways. Here are some key mechanisms:

  1. Hormonal Imbalance: Alcohol consumption can disrupt the balance of hormones in the body. It increases the conversion of testosterone to estrogen, a hormone that has the opposite effect of testosterone. This can lower the overall testosterone levels, making TT less effective.
  2. Liver Function: The liver plays a crucial role in hormone regulation. It helps metabolize and clear hormones from the bloodstream. Alcohol is processed by the liver, and excessive drinking can damage liver cells, impairing their ability to function properly. This can result in slower processing of testosterone, reducing the therapy's effectiveness.
  3. Inflammation and Oxidative Stress: Alcohol can cause inflammation and oxidative stress in the body. These conditions can affect the endocrine system, which regulates hormone production and release. Chronic inflammation can lead to a decrease in testosterone production, counteracting the benefits of TT.
  4. Sleep Disruption: Alcohol consumption, especially in large amounts, can disrupt sleep patterns. Quality sleep is vital for the production and regulation of hormones, including testosterone. Poor sleep can reduce the effectiveness of TT as it can lower natural testosterone levels.

Does the Type of Alcohol Matter?

When it comes to understanding how alcohol affects testosterone therapy (TT), it's important to consider not just the amount of alcohol consumed but also the type of alcohol. Different kinds of alcoholic beverages, such as beer, wine, and spirits, can have varying impacts on testosterone levels and the effectiveness of TT. Let's explore these differences and understand how each type of alcohol interacts with TT.

Beer and Testosterone Therapy

Beer is one of the most commonly consumed alcoholic beverages. It contains alcohol, hops, and barley, among other ingredients. One of the unique aspects of beer is that it contains phytoestrogens, which are plant-derived compounds that mimic the hormone estrogen. Estrogen is known to lower testosterone levels in the body.

  • Impact on Testosterone Levels: The phytoestrogens in beer can contribute to lower testosterone levels. This is because estrogen and testosterone are balanced in the body. When estrogen levels increase, testosterone levels often decrease. For men undergoing TT, drinking beer regularly can counteract the benefits of the therapy by lowering testosterone levels or preventing them from rising as intended.
  • Liver Health: Another factor to consider is the impact of beer on the liver. The liver plays a crucial role in metabolizing both alcohol and testosterone. Consuming beer in large quantities can strain the liver, potentially impairing its ability to process testosterone effectively. This can reduce the effectiveness of TT and increase the risk of liver damage.

Wine and Testosterone Therapy

Wine, particularly red wine, is often considered a healthier alcoholic choice due to its antioxidants. However, wine still contains alcohol, and its effects on TT must be understood.

  • Antioxidants and Hormones: Red wine contains resveratrol, an antioxidant that has been studied for its potential health benefits. Some studies suggest that resveratrol might help improve heart health and reduce inflammation. However, when it comes to testosterone, the alcohol content in wine can still pose issues. While the antioxidants in red wine can offer some health benefits, they do not counteract the negative effects of alcohol on testosterone levels.
  • Impact on Testosterone Levels: Like beer, wine consumption can lower testosterone levels. Alcohol can disrupt the endocrine system, leading to reduced testosterone production. For those on TT, this can mean that the therapy is less effective in achieving the desired hormone levels.
  • Moderation is Key: Drinking wine in moderation is crucial. Moderate alcohol consumption is defined as up to one drink per day for women and up to two drinks per day for men. Exceeding these amounts can lead to negative health outcomes, including reduced effectiveness of TT.

Spirits and Testosterone Therapy

Spirits, such as vodka, whiskey, rum, and gin, are typically consumed in smaller quantities due to their higher alcohol content. These drinks are often mixed with other beverages, which can affect how they are metabolized.

  • High Alcohol Content: Spirits have a higher alcohol content compared to beer and wine. This means that even small amounts can have a significant impact on testosterone levels. The higher alcohol concentration can more rapidly affect liver function and hormone metabolism.
  • Mixers and Added Sugars: Many people consume spirits with mixers like soda or juice, which can add a significant amount of sugar to the drink. High sugar intake can lead to insulin resistance, which is linked to lower testosterone levels. Additionally, mixers can increase calorie intake, potentially leading to weight gain, another factor that can negatively impact testosterone levels.
  • Impact on Liver Health: Given their high alcohol content, spirits can place a considerable strain on the liver. As with other types of alcohol, overconsumption of spirits can impair liver function, making it difficult for the body to process testosterone effectively. This can reduce the benefits of TT and increase the risk of liver damage.

Defining Safe Limits for Alcohol Consumption

When discussing safe alcohol consumption, it's helpful to understand standard measurements. A standard drink in the United States is typically defined as:

  • 12 ounces of beer (5% alcohol content)
  • 5 ounces of wine (12% alcohol content)
  • 1.5 ounces of distilled spirits (40% alcohol content)

Moderate drinking is generally defined as up to one drink per day for women and up to two drinks per day for men. However, these guidelines might change for someone undergoing TT due to potential interactions between alcohol and the therapy.
